The Elecro Vulcan heaters are supplied with hose tail adapters for connection to flexible pipework. Construction consists of a flow tube which is fitted with Inlet and Outlet mouldings manufactured from specially formulated polymer alloy material. Universal ABS unions are provided to allow solvent weld connection to the inlet and outlet pipe work. The outlet moulding accommodates a reversible flow switch with a gold tipped reed, and Titanium fulcrum pin. The heater is supported on two swivel feet; these can swivel to permit either wall or floor mounting.

The Elecro Vulcan swimming pool heaters come fully equipped and pre-wired including a super sensitive flow switch, that allows safe coupling to most above ground pools. Please check the technical page of the manufacturers for information on connectivity to your pool before purchase. Please click here for more details

The connections supplied with your Elecro heater are a stepped 1¼" BSP & 1½" BSP (British Standard Pipe). If your Intex pool uses 1.5" hoses with threaded nuts you may wish to buy 2 x Adapter B's (part 10722) and a piece of 1.5" hose (part 11010) which are available from John Adams in the UK to make a sealed connection. It is also possible to make the connection to the 1½" (38-mm) part of the hosetail using 2 jubilee clips & silicone sealant at each side of the heater.

The heater requires only final connection to a mandatory separate RCD. No pump interlock is required. All heaters come fitted with 1.5'' BSP female threaded adapters for connection to all pipework.

The desired pool temperature can be easily set on the Vulcan heater using the panel-mounted thermostat dial in the case of the analogue model, in respect of the digital model by using the touch buttons, resulting in the temperatures being displayed on the LCD screen. Over-temperature protection is provided by the thermal cut out (manual reset).

Frequently Asked Questions

Q - How long does it take to bring a pool up to temperature?
A - Assuming no heat losses, and a heater sized in the ratio 1.5-kW per 1000-gallons of water: it will take 2 days of continuous running to raise the temperature of a pool from tap temperature to swimming temperature. Heat loss will slow the process particularly during periods of cold weather, i.e. the higher the temperature is to be maintained above average ambient air temperature the slower the heating process will become. The main influencing factor being the level of heat retaining insulation incorporated in the pool shell.

Q - Can I plug my heater in via a standard 3-pin plug?
A - Heater sizes 2-kW and 3-kW can be plugged in via a standard 3-pin domestic plug. Heater sizes 4.5-kW and above require wiring to the property's main consumer unit - the same way a shower or cooker is normally wired. To check the power consumption of your heater please see the tank label of the heater (located on the heaters flow tube)

Q - How much will it cost to heat my pool?
A - Assuming the cost of a unit of electricity to be 6 pence it will cost £4.32 to heat 1000-gallons (4500-Litres) of water from tap temperature to a reasonable swimming temperature. This equation makes no allowance for heat loss.

The cost of maintaining the water temperature will be dependant on the level of insulation given by the pool structure, a moderately well insulated pool being used only during summer months may only require 3 hours of top up heat on average per day. At a cost of 27 pence per 1000-gallons (when the heater is sized in the ratio 1.5-kW per 1000-gallons). The religious use of a solar floating cover could dispense with the need for any top up heat being required during warm sunny days.

Q - My pool's flexible pipe is slightly larger than the fittings supplied
A - The connections supplied with your Elecro heater are a stepped 1¼" BSP & 1½" BSP (British Standard Pipe). Above ground pool manufacturers can have non-standard pipe work. It is possible to make a correct connection to the heater hosetail using 2 jubilee clips & silicone sealant at each side of the heater.

If you are unable to achieve this you will need to source a connection / adapter that goes from 1½" BSP thread to the size you require for your pipe work, you could try plumbing merchants or your local swimming pool shop.

If you do not wish to cut the return pipe to the pool then adapters are available that will reduce the thread from the 1.5" BSP to suit smaller hoses

Please note the above information is for guidance only & running costs will vary from pool to pool and will be dependant on the following main points:

The Level Of Insulation
Water Temperature to be Maintained
Average Ambient Air Temperature
The Cost of a Unit of Electricity
Wind Chill
